电子信息类学什么编程好

不及物动词 其他 13

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在电子信息类专业中,学习编程是非常重要的。编程技能可以帮助学生更好地理解和应用电子信息学科的知识,提高解决问题的能力,并为未来的职业发展提供更多机会。那么,在电子信息类专业中,学哪些编程语言比较好呢?

    首先,C语言是电子信息类专业中非常重要的一门编程语言。C语言是一种高级编程语言,它具有简单、灵活、高效等特点,适用于嵌入式系统和硬件开发。学习C语言可以帮助学生掌握基本的编程思想和技巧,为以后学习其他编程语言打下坚实的基础。

    其次,Python是一门功能强大且易于学习的编程语言,也适合电子信息类专业的学生。Python具有简洁的语法和丰富的库,可以用于数据处理、机器学习、人工智能等领域。学习Python可以帮助学生快速实现自己的想法,并且在实际项目中应用。

    此外,对于电子信息类专业的学生来说,还可以学习一些硬件描述语言,如Verilog和VHDL。这些语言用于描述数字电路和系统,可以帮助学生理解数字电路的设计和实现原理。掌握硬件描述语言可以让学生在FPGA、ASIC等领域进行开发和设计。

    除了以上几种编程语言,学习电子信息类专业的学生还可以根据自己的兴趣和需求选择其他编程语言,如Java、C++等。重要的是要掌握一门或多门编程语言,并能够灵活应用于实际项目中。

    总之,对于电子信息类专业的学生来说,学习编程是非常重要的。C语言、Python以及硬件描述语言等都是非常适合电子信息类专业学生学习的编程语言。通过学习这些编程语言,可以提高学生的编程能力,为未来的职业发展打下坚实的基础。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    电子信息类学生在选择学习编程时,可以考虑以下几种编程语言:

    1. C语言:C语言是一种通用的编程语言,广泛应用于嵌入式系统开发、操作系统、驱动程序等领域。它的语法简洁,易于学习,并且具有高效的执行速度。学习C语言可以帮助学生深入理解计算机底层原理和数据结构。

    2. Python:Python是一种高级编程语言,具有简单易读的语法和丰富的库函数,适合初学者入门。Python在数据处理、人工智能、科学计算等领域有着广泛的应用,学习Python可以帮助学生快速开发实用的应用程序。

    3. Java:Java是一种跨平台的编程语言,广泛应用于企业级应用开发和Android应用开发。Java具有强大的面向对象编程能力和丰富的类库,学习Java可以帮助学生掌握面向对象编程思想和开发大型软件系统的能力。

    4. MATLAB:MATLAB是一种用于数值计算和科学工程计算的编程语言和环境。它具有丰富的数学和工程计算函数库,适用于信号处理、图像处理、控制系统等领域。学习MATLAB可以帮助学生进行科学计算和数据分析。

    5. VHDL:VHDL是一种硬件描述语言,用于描述数字电路和系统。它在电子设计自动化(EDA)领域有着广泛的应用,适用于FPGA设计和ASIC设计。学习VHDL可以帮助学生理解数字电路的设计和实现原理。

    总之,对于电子信息类学生来说,选择适合自己需求和兴趣的编程语言很重要。可以根据个人的学习目标和职业规划,选择学习一门或多门编程语言,提升自己的编程能力和就业竞争力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在电子信息类学科中,学习编程是非常重要和实用的。编程能够帮助学生提高问题解决能力、创造力和逻辑思维能力,并且能够为他们未来的职业发展提供更多机会。下面列举几个在电子信息类学科中学习编程的好处和推荐的编程语言。

    一、学习编程的好处

    1. 提高问题解决能力:编程是一种解决问题的方法,学习编程可以培养学生的问题分析和解决能力,让他们能够更好地应对各种挑战。
    2. 培养创造力:编程是一种创造性的活动,通过编程学习,学生可以发挥他们的想象力,创造出各种有趣和实用的应用程序。
    3. 增强逻辑思维能力:编程需要严谨的逻辑思维,学习编程可以帮助学生提高逻辑思维能力,培养他们的分析和推理能力。
    4. 为职业发展提供机会:随着科技的发展,编程成为了许多行业中的必备技能,学习编程可以为学生将来的职业发展提供更多机会。

    二、推荐的编程语言

    1. C语言:C语言是一种通用的编程语言,广泛应用于嵌入式系统和硬件控制方面。学习C语言可以帮助学生理解计算机底层原理和编程基础知识。
    2. Python语言:Python语言是一种简单易学的高级编程语言,具有丰富的库和工具,适合初学者学习。Python在数据处理、人工智能和科学计算等领域有广泛应用。
    3. Java语言:Java语言是一种面向对象的编程语言,具有跨平台的特性,适合开发各种应用程序。学习Java语言可以为学生提供更多的职业发展机会。
    4. MATLAB语言:MATLAB是一种数学计算和科学工程计算的编程语言,广泛应用于信号处理、图像处理和控制系统等领域。学习MATLAB可以帮助学生掌握相关的专业知识和技能。

    三、学习编程的方法和操作流程

    1. 学习基础知识:首先,学生需要学习编程的基础知识,包括语法、数据类型、变量、运算符等。可以通过阅读教材、参加在线课程或参加编程培训班来学习基础知识。
    2. 刷题练习:学生可以通过刷题练习来巩固所学的知识,并且提高编程能力。可以选择一些在线的编程练习平台或参加编程竞赛来进行刷题练习。
    3. 实践项目:学生可以选择一些小项目来实践所学的编程知识,例如制作一个简单的游戏、开发一个网站或者设计一个控制系统。通过实践项目可以提高学生的动手能力和解决问题的能力。
    4. 参与开源项目:学生可以参与一些开源项目,通过和其他开发者合作来提高编程能力和学习经验。可以选择一些与电子信息相关的开源项目,例如开发开源硬件设备或者参与开源软件的开发。

    总之,学习编程对于电子信息类学科的学生来说是非常有益的。通过学习编程,学生可以提高问题解决能力、创造力和逻辑思维能力,并且为他们未来的职业发展提供更多机会。同时,选择合适的编程语言并采取正确的学习方法和操作流程,可以帮助学生更好地掌握编程技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部